If Clemson could have held on to one or the other for 20+ years, which would have had the bigger long-term impact on our football program?

Would keeping Heisman on our campus during the embryonic days of college football in the USA have made us into what schools like Alabama are today instead of wandering in the wilderness in the 1920s and 1930s?

Would Danny Ford's extended tenure here seen us take our place alongside the side the neuveaux riche of college football, a multi-time MNC champ and fixture in the top-10.

Which would have been more important to Clemson if you had to choose only one???

... school is still out, but the scores are coming in and looking better every week.

But, I have to say (of those two) that keeping Heisman would have been the greater long term positive for Clemson.

Those were the days when storied programs were created from scratch and there was no reason why Clemson was less poised for greatness than Alabama, Auburn, Georgia, Georgia Tech or any number of other schools. We just let the greatest coach of his era leave us for "greener" pastures.

John Hesiman would have built a giant at Clemson


Sep 10, 2013, 7:43 PM

We would probably be in the SEC if he had been here for 20+ years. We would have won tons of games and perhaps even championships like he did at GT.

Danny would have also made an impact if the above did not happen. He WOULD have won the 1990 National Championship. Clemson would have challenged FSU for dominance in the ACC in the 90's and 2000's.
